Brenda Schwartz joined the firm in 2014 and practices in the areas of estate planning and taxation, business succession planning, business law, NFA Trusts and probate litigation.

Ms. Schwartz graduated with honors from The University of Akron School of Law with a Summa Cum Laude distinction. She was also Valedictorian of her class. She was an Articles Editor of the Akron Law Review, and was the recipient of the Donald Jenkins Scholarship Award for Top Graduate. Ms. Schwartz earned her undergraduate degree from The Ohio State University where she also graduated with a Summa Cum Laude distinction.

Ms. Schwartz is a member of the Akron and Ohio State Bar Associations, and is a fellow of the Akron Bar Foundation.

In 2009, Ms. Schwartz was honored with the Murrary Glauberman Young Leadership Award. Civic and professional involvement is also very important to Ms. Schwartz. She is a member of the Jewish Community Board of Akron, and member and secretary of the Akron Civil War Memorial Society, Historic Glendale Cemetery and Friends of Historic Glendale Cemetery.
